Actual cost of on-premise storage •  Tradi7onal  Providers  Quote  and  Sell  “Raw”,  Unprotected  Gigabytes  of   Capacity   •  Protec7on  Methods  (RAID,  Mirror  and  Erasure  Codes)  are  addi7onal     •  File  and  Opera7ng  System  space  is  addi7onal   •  U7liza7on  Factor  (Growth  Buffers)  is  addi7onal     •     RAW  Price    +  25%  Protec7on  +  7%  Overhead  +  15%  U7liza7on   •     Usable  Per  Gigabyte  Price  =  RAW  +  almost  50%   •     If  you  have  a  Disaster  Recovery  Site    –  Your  Numbers  Double    
  • 28. Inputs  to  calculate  storage  total  cost  –  5  Data  Points   1.  RAW  Storage  Selling  Price,  Capacity,  Data  Protec7on  Method  (Up7me  SLA)   2.  Data  Center  or  Coloca7on  Hos7ng  Expense   3.  Network  (Core,  Distribu7on,  Load  Balancers,  and  Bandwidth)     4.  Staff  Labor  (Architecture,  Opera7ng,  Sustainment,  and  Management)     5.  Cost  of  Funds  /  Cost  of  Capital

Let’s  start  by  defining  what  we  mean   •  A  backup  or  the  process  of  backing  up  is  making  copies  of  data   which  may  be  used  to  restore  the  original  aaer  a  data  loss  event.  The   primary  purpose  is  to  recover  data  aaer  its  loss,  be  it  by  data  dele7on  or   corrup7on.  The  secondary  purpose  of  backups  is  to  recover  data  from   an  earlier  7me.   •  Archiving  is  the  process  of  moving  data  that  is  no  longer  ac7vely   used  to  a  separate  data  storage  device  for  long-­‐term  reten7on.   Data  archives  are  indexed  and  have  search  capabili7es  so  that   files  and  parts  of  files  can  be  easily  located  and  retrieved.   •  Disaster  recovery  (DR)  is  the  process,  policies  and  procedures   related  to  preparing  for  recovery  or  con7nua7on  of  technology   infrastructure  cri7cal  to  an  organiza7on  aaer  a  natural  or   human-­‐induced  disaster.

Storage  Gateway  –  Connect  On-­‐Prem  with  the  AWS  Cloud   1.  Local,  low-­‐latency  access  to  the   most  frequently  used  files  while   storing  all  data  in  Amazon  S3   (Cached-­‐Volumes)     Or     2.  Scheduled  off-­‐site  backups  to   Amazon  S3  for  on-­‐premises  data   (Stored-­‐Volumes)
